Instructions of Temperature Sensors
The gap between the protective tube of the thermocouple and the wall is not filled with insulating material, causing heat overflow or cold in the furnace.
Air invades, so the gap between the thermocouple protection tube and the furnace wall hole should be blocked with insulating materials such as refractory mud or asbestos rope to prevent hot and cold air convection from affecting theaccuracy of temperature measurement.
The cold end of the thermocouple is too close to the furnace body, causing the temperature to exceed 100℃.
The installation of thermocouples should avoid strong magnetic fields and strong electric fields as much as possible, so thermocouples and power cables should not be installed in the same conduit to avoid interference and errors.
Thermocouples cannot be installed where the measured medium rarely flows. In an area where a thermocouple is used to measure the gas temperature in the tube, the thermocouple must be installed against the direction of flow velocity andfully in contact with the gas.
